Two items, based on the pictures that you posted:

  1. Please cover the three power cables better. Maybe more heat-shrink tubing. If the metal connectors touch - you get to buy another control board. This has nothing to do with your problem but it's worth addressing.
  2. Your control board is not attached to the shell. I will bet @Hunka Hunka Burning Love's $5 that this is the problem. The gyro on the control board is amazingly sensitive and your control board is somewhat floating within the wheel. There should be one screw in each corner of the control board that tightens the board to the shell. Please add those missing screws and then start enjoying your wheel again.

Have just seen your other post 

These connections worked out fine soldering? (?Very?) theoretically if this wire to connector soldering was done not sufficient a high contact resistance between wires and connector could also lead to problems. Main problem could be that they desolder themself once they are under high load, but if they have very bad contact (cold soldering joint) this could eventually also lead to balancing probs?

Although a not tightened motherboard has imo still the number one probability.

Good news

I don't understand what you exactly mean by "tucked the wires in". Which wires? Tucked where?

Your description sounds like maybe one of the connectors on the board isn't seated properly.

Generally you should be able to wiggle any of the wires and nothing should happen. Maybe double-check all of the connections to the control board?
